Dealing with the loss of a parent can be tough for anyone to handle. When you run your own business even more so - because you there’s no paid compassionate leave to fall back on. And you can’t just hand your clients/commitments over to someone else until you’re feeling ready to face the world. In this episode of the Courageous podcast, you’ll hear from Communications Consultants Lucy Davies - who has lost both her parents over the past few years - and shares her experience in this interview (along with practical strategies to help).

Key Moments

00:01:53 The emotional and practical challenges of balancing work and caring for ill family members

00:06:23 How Lucy's father's illness affected her consultancy and client relationships

00:09:04 What Lucy learned about safeguarding her business after her father's passing

00:17:09 How certain memories and moments can unexpectedly evoke strong emotions

00:21:10 The impact of stepping into a caring role on Lucy's self-identity

00:23:21 How Lucy is now protecting her business and income streams for the future
